Transaction 8564bc5082b5ff95f05fd4e605d1baf7dbada0c694ae7220e6b5a12e6f275261
1 Input
1 Output
-
8564bc5082b5ff95f05fd4e605d1baf7dbada0c694ae7220e6b5a12e6f275261:0
- value
- 280000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6329620be0a35cb96696221498b70386636569f7 OP_EQUAL
- address
- 3AjLPskNWBMrdfQv5sjnfmC4gzC8qem7gA